I don’t really get into the Christmas in July spirit, but it is a good reminder that if you want to make holiday gifts you had best get started.
If you want to cross stitch some holiday ornaments for your own tree or for people on your list, check out this cute round ornament pattern from Stitching the Night Away.
It has a snowflake pattern with hearts and is just really sweet and simple to stitch. It’s worked in one color and fits in a three-inch hoop. Bonus points for using sparkly fabric (or sparkly thread!)
